Output 6f42c0ba83f95fcc92eec3efae3c630004dd835098b2829c12c7e23c0f7b5c2e:34

value
27953685
script pubkey
OP_0 OP_PUSHBYTES_20 ba0e86ede52077f963b995a1873d18c6d3cd4e90
address
bc1qhg8gdm09ypmljcaejkscw0gccmfu6n5s5espfu
transaction
6f42c0ba83f95fcc92eec3efae3c630004dd835098b2829c12c7e23c0f7b5c2e
spent
true